/**
30
 * Asynchronous library
31
 *
32
 * The aim of this library is facilitating writing programs utilizing 
33
 * the asynchronous nature of Helenos IPC, yet using a normal way
34
 * of programming. 
35
 *
36
 * You should be able to write very simple multithreaded programs, 
37
 * the async framework will automatically take care of most synchronization
38
 * problems.
39
 *
40
 * Default semantics:
41
 * - send() - send asynchronously. If the kernel refuses to send more
42
 *            messages, [ try to get responses from kernel, if nothing
43
 *            found, might try synchronous ]
44
 *
45
 * Example of use:
46
 * 
47
 * 1) Multithreaded client application
48
 *  create_thread(thread1);
49
 *  create_thread(thread2);
50
 *  ...
51
 *  
52
 *  thread1() {
53
 *        conn = ipc_connect_me_to();
54
 *        c1 = send(conn);
55
 *        c2 = send(conn);
56
 *        wait_for(c1);
57
 *        wait_for(c2);
58
 *  }
59
 *
60
 *
61
 * 2) Multithreaded server application
62
 * main() {
1407 palkovsky 63
 *      async_manager();
1392 palkovsky 64
 * }
65
 * 
66
 *
1407 palkovsky 67
 * client_connection(icallid, *icall) {
68
 *       if (want_refuse) {
69
 *           ipc_answer_fast(icallid, ELIMIT, 0, 0);
70
 *           return;
71
 *       }
72
 *       ipc_answer_fast(icallid, 0, 0, 0);
1392 palkovsky 73
 *
1407 palkovsky 74
 *       callid = async_get_call(&call);
75
 *       handle(callid, call);
76
 *       ipc_answer_fast(callid, 1,2,3);
77
 *
78
 *       callid = async_get_call(&call);
1392 palkovsky 79
 *       ....
80
 * }
1404 palkovsky 81
 *
1405 decky 82
 * TODO: Detaching/joining dead psthreads?
1392 palkovsky 83
 */

/** Thread function that gets created on new connection
211
 *
212
 * This function is defined as a weak symbol - to be redefined in
213
 * user code.
214
 */
1392 palkovsky 215
void client_connection(ipc_callid_t callid, ipc_call_t *call)
216
{
1404 palkovsky 217
	ipc_answer_fast(callid, ENOENT, 0, 0);
1392 palkovsky 218
}
1351 palkovsky 219
 
1404 palkovsky 220
/** Wrapper for client connection thread
221
 *
222
 * When new connection arrives, thread with this function is created.
223
 * It calls client_connection and does final cleanup.
224
 *
225
 * @parameter arg Connection structure pointer
226
 */
1392 palkovsky 227
static int connection_thread(void  *arg)
1351 palkovsky 228
{
1404 palkovsky 229
	unsigned long key;
230
	msg_t *msg;
1408 palkovsky 231
	connection_t *conn;
1404 palkovsky 232
 
1392 palkovsky 233
	/* Setup thread local connection pointer */
234
	PS_connection = (connection_t *)arg;
1408 palkovsky 235
	conn = PS_connection;
236
	conn->cthread(conn->callid, &conn->call);
1392 palkovsky 237
 
1404 palkovsky 238
	/* Remove myself from connection hash table */
1392 palkovsky 239
	futex_down(&conn_futex);
1408 palkovsky 240
	key = conn->in_phone_hash;
1404 palkovsky 241
	hash_table_remove(&conn_hash_table, &key, 1);
1392 palkovsky 242
	futex_up(&conn_futex);
1404 palkovsky 243
	/* Answer all remaining messages with ehangup */
1408 palkovsky 244
	while (!list_empty(&conn->msg_queue)) {
245
		msg = list_get_instance(conn->msg_queue.next, msg_t, link);
1404 palkovsky 246
		list_remove(&msg->link);
247
		ipc_answer_fast(msg->callid, EHANGUP, 0, 0);
248
		free(msg);
249
	}
1351 palkovsky 250
}
